Honors Ambassadors

Honors ambassadors maintain connections with students and the public by setting up signs, manning the front desk, and assisting at events.


Honors ambassadors are a dynamic student team who serve as liaisons for guest services and building operations at the Judy Genshaft Honors College. Honors ambassadors are more than Honors team members; they're the bridge that connects the Honors College to the greater community. Beyond helping with daily operations, these student leaders assist in ensuring that all visitors, including current students, USF faculty and staff, prospective students, alumni, and others enjoy a positive experience whenever they interact with the Judy Genshaft Honors College.  

Judy Genshaft Honors College ambassadors:

  • Provide a positive first impression and guest service experience for all visitors
  • Support inquiries from visitors and potential students
  • Assist staff by monitoring incoming phone calls and messages
  • Maintain an organized and welcoming front desk environment
  • Assist with building operations, special events, and more
